Captain Miguelín: "The team are focused and excited so that 2017 is much better" (27/12/2016)

The captain of El Pozo Murcia FS, Miguel Sayago Martí 'Miguelín' radiates happiness on all four sides.

And it's no wonder.

Christmas Eve brought him the most precious gift, his first son named Didier and forever Murcia.

The mother and the little one are very well and today they start a new life at home.

"Very happy, we live a very special moment," he said after congratulating the media.

Likewise, the newly released father wanted to thank the Hospital Virgen de la Arrixaca "the treatment they have given us, the nurses and matron with an excellent service, took care of us perfectly and did not neglect any details."

On Thursday, the competition returns to Gran Canaria at the Palacio de los Deportes, at 20 hours, and last of 2016. A good opportunity to give the victory to the fans.

As the captain said: "The important thing is to get the three points this Thursday, and if it is with much better goals, we have missed a lot of points at home."

Although he said that "overall, 2016 has been quite positive, meeting expectations and I see the team very focused and excited so that 2017 is much better."

Also, the captain makes a balance of 2016 to four days to conclude the year, "in a comfortable situation to be already in the Copa del Rey Semifinals, third in regular League and we have won the first title of the season - the Spanish Supercup - position by which any team would change for us ".

Of course, "we have to be more humble, to continue working and trusting because if we want to win important things we must be united, team and hobby, so that by 2017 the Palace will be a big fort."

In this sense, he also explained that "in the league it is true that we could be higher by the setbacks at home, but it is a positive balance. Since we are in the semifinals of the King's Cup eliminating Palma and Catgas always home."

Personal Balance

The captain said that "whenever the team wins titles and is where I think it has to be, it is positive. I feel good, confident and at a high level but it is necessary to keep it, it is not worth relaxing with daily work. Those who come from the branch, and also to feel good about what they do. "
